Bod Deiniol

Bod Deiniol submitted by TimPrevett on 1st Jul 2002. Bod Deiniol SH368857 Visited Tuesday 15th June 1999 Access: We parked at nearby Llyn Alaw reservoir visitors' centre car park (some of the lanes to here are very narrow and bendy!). The stone I estimated about 10 to 11 feet tall, about 6 feet at its widest; covered in lichen. One side very smooth, and one side very rough.

Bodfan Standing Stone

Bodfan Standing Stone submitted by nicoladidsbury on 24th Apr 2006. The stone is listed on the OS maps. The nearest farm is called Bodfan, so it seemed like a sensible name, although it may have a proper name. The hills in the distance are to the south, from left to right - Bwlch Mwar, Gryn Goch, Gryn Ddu, and the three peaks of Yr Eifl, the first one if which is the marvellous hillfort of Tre'r Ceiri.
